A vacancy has arisen for a Flight Lieutenant (Any Profession) to serve as Executive Officer at 504 Sqn RAuxAF RAF Wittering on Full Time Reserve Service (Limited Commitment) Terms and Conditions of Service (TCoS) with an initial proposed start date of 27 July 2026 (or earlier/later subject to candidate status).
504 (County of Nottingham) Sqns mission is to attract train employ and retain reservist logisticians and engineers committed to delivering support to Air and Defence operations exercises and diverse tasks across the UK and overseas; and to raise the profile of 504 Sqn celebrating its proud history and promote the work of the RAF Reserves.
The Sqn Executive Officer (XO) is responsible to OC 504 Sqn for the effective overall management of 504 Sqns operational training support and engagement functions and delivery of required outputs. XO 504 Sqn is also responsible for the administration welfare and discipline of all FTRS and PTVR personnel under the command of OC 504 Sqn.
Specifically XO 504 Sqn will be required to:
- Act as the Deputy Sqn Cdr and Junior Subordinate Commander for all 504 Sqn personnel.
- Act as Flt Cdr and Reporting Officer for 504 Sqn Ops/Delivery and Spt staff.
- Manage and supervise all functional areas ranging from training HR and operations.
- Provide mentoring and support to PTVR Flt Cdrs and Trg Off as appropriate.
- Actively contribute to internal and external CI/change programmes to optimise efficiency and effectiveness of all representative capabilities and outputs of 504 Sqn.
- Oversee the effective delivery of sqn mobilisation and tasking processes.
- Oversee career management of all PTVR personnel ensuring talent management strategies are applied as appropriate.
- Assure the provision of trained Logistics Drivers Chefs Suppliers and Ground Engineering Technicians (Electrical and Mechanical) personnel to support sqn outputs.
- Ensure co-ordination of Sqn/Flt Duty/Training Programmes taking account of operational commitments recruitment force development adventurous and physical training engagement and ceremonial activities.
- Management administration and development of the Sqns Marketing and Engagement Plan.
- Administration of Sqn XXs meetings.
- Manage the Sqn Workforce Establishment.
- Act as the Unit Employer Support Officer (UESO). This involves being the focal point for employer support and employer engagement activity.
- Regularly engage proactively with key stakeholders such as; Spt Fce HQ and FEs other Reserves Logs Spt Sqns Stn Execs Eng and Logs Reserves HQ Employer Engagement Teams AREEO RFCA HQ R&S Adjudication Team and Reserves Directorate staffs.
- Maintain oversight of Annual Bounty qualifications for the COs Certificate of Efficiency.
- Undertake the role of Deputy Budget Manager for the Sqn.
- Ensure optimum sqn preparedness for the Annual Capability Audit.
- Co-ordinate and maintain the Sqn Business Continuity Plan.
- Review and update PARMIS sqn risks as required.
- Complete and submit the monthly F540 submissions and capture monthly workforce data.
- Undertake the role and duties of the Flight Safety Officer.
- Manage the Sqn Quality Improvement Action Plan (QIAP).
- Act as the 504 Sqn Security Officer (SyO).
- Staffing citations for EoY/Inspectorate/HAC submissions Honours & Awards RFCA Updates etc and manage other routine and ad-hoc administration and submissions as required.
The post holder will be required to work some weekends (usually one per month) and participate in other sqn training events and exercises as necessary including support to Annual Continuous Training events and supporting ceremonial FD/AT and engagement events which may occasionally take place over weekends and evenings.
Whilst there may be some capacity for hybrid working as this role has significant command responsibilities the XO will be expected to spend the majority of their time working from the Sqn HQ at RAF Wittering.
